Substance Use Disorder Resources Near Santa Clarita, CA
Addiction affects families in Santa Clarita and Los Angeles County through alcohol use disorders, opioid addiction, methamphetamine dependency, and prescription drug abuse. Resources available include medical detoxification, residential treatment programs, partial hospitalization programs, intensive outpatient services, and community support groups.
According to 2024 NSDUH data, 9.7% of U.S. individuals aged 12+ (roughly 27.9 million, or 1 in 10) experienced past-year AUD. Santa Clarita, CA, had a 2024 population of approximately 228,700, with ~97% (222,000) aged 12+ (excluding under-5 at ~5.8% and 5-9 at ~6.2%, partial 10-14). This equates to ~21,500 residents with AUD, a figure that grows notably when factoring in other SUDs such as opioids or methamphetamine (national total SUD: 16.8%).

Does Insurance Cover Drug & Alcohol Rehab?
Yes, federal law requires insurance providers to cover addiction treatment as an essential health benefit, with most plans covering 80 to 100 percent of treatment costs, including services like Partial Hospitalization Programs (PHP) and Intensive Outpatient Programs (IOP). The Affordable Care Act (ACA) and the Mental Health Parity and Addiction Equity Act ensure that substance use disorder treatment receives coverage equal to other medical and surgical benefits.
Santa Clarita residents with private insurance can expect coverage for medically necessary addiction treatment, including therapy, counseling, medication management, and case management services. Out-of-pocket costs typically include only deductibles, copays, and coinsurance. Request free insurance verification to understand your exact coverage and costs before beginning treatment.

No, your employer will not find out if you go to drug and alcohol rehab. Addiction treatment is protected by HIPAA confidentiality laws, meaning your employer cannot access information about your treatment without written consent. The Family and Medical Leave Act (FMLA) provides job protection for eligible employees seeking addiction treatment, allowing you to take medical leave without disclosing specific details to HR. You may also use vacation time, sick leave, or FMLA leave to receive necessary care. California state employment protections prevent discrimination based on seeking addiction treatment, and case managers can help with necessary paperwork.
